Cerumen
The technical term for earwax, a substance produced by glands in the ear canal that protects the ears from dust, microorganisms, and other foreign particles.
Electronystagmography
A diagnostic test to record involuntary movements of the eye (nystagmus) caused by a condition or as a response to a test.
Auditory-evoked Response
An electrical potential in response to an auditory stimulus, used to assess hearing and brainstem function.
Tympanometry
A diagnostic test that measures the movement of the eardrum in response to changes in air pressure, indicating middle ear function.
